Cuestión : Un botón y una imagen dentro de un tileList

1:
2:
3:
4:
5:
                    

1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
16:
17:
18:
19:
20:
tileList_itemClick privado de la función (evt: ListEvent): vacío { 
                img = nueva imagen (); 
                // img.width = 300; 
                // img.height = 300; 
                img.maintainAspectRatio = verdad; 
                img.addEventListener (Event.COMPLETE, image_complete); 
                img.addEventListener (ResizeEvent.RESIZE, image_resize); 
                img.addEventListener (MouseEvent.MOUSE_OUT, image_click); 
				img.addEventListener (MouseEvent.MOUSE_DOWN, image_start_drag);
				img.addEventListener (MouseEvent.MOUSE_UP, image_stop_drag);				
                img.source = “http://localhost/funktion/templates/index/productimg/big/” + No. (evt.itemRenderer.data.spic);
				//Alert.show (img.source.toString ());
                img.setStyle (“addedEffect”, image_addedEffect); 
                img.setStyle (“removedEffect”, image_removedEffect); 
                ¡si (evt.itemRenderer.data.spic! = “no_photo80x80.gif”) {
				PopUpManager.addPopUp (el img, éste, verdad); 
		}
				
            

1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
 
 
  
  

	
     
	


  



El problema es, el itemClick del tilelist cubrirá el onclick del botón o la función del tecleo de la imagen. eso medios,
quiero solamente chascar la imagen para agrandar la imagen, y chasco la caja alerta de la demostración del botón. Pero ahora, chasco el botón (que chasca realmente el artículo del azulejo), también agrandaré la imagen y demostraré la caja alerta….

Respuesta : Un botón y una imagen dentro de un tileList

En la etiqueta del botón definir a tratante de acontecimiento del tecleo dicen su btn_clickHandler (el acontecimiento)

btn_clickHandler privado de la función (acontecimiento: MouseEvent): vacío {
         //Do lo que usted quiere hacer cuando se chasca el botón
       
       parada de //Then la propagación del acontecimiento del tecleo
       event.stopImmediatePropagation ();
}


usted puede hacer iguales con la imagen.
Otras soluciones  
 
programming4us programming4us